The sacred face (Mukharvind) of Giriraj Ji where Lord Krishna accepted thousands of food offerings during Annakut festival.

Mukharvind Mandir (Jatipura & Mansi Ganga) located in Govardhan welcomes all pilgrims daily with completely free entry. Darshan is open in two daily shifts: morning from 05:00 AM to 01:00 PM and evening from 04:00 PM to 10:00 PM. The sanctum observes a standard afternoon closure daily between 12:00 PM and 04:00 PM for deity Rajbhog and resting.

Pilgrims offer Panchamrit, betel leaves, and traditional makkhan mishri bhog.
No, entry to Mukharvind Mandir (Jatipura & Mansi Ganga) is completely free for all pilgrims and devotees. Standard darshan queues are open to the general public with no mandatory paid tickets.
Morning darshan is best between 06:00 AM to 11:30 AM, and evening darshan opens between 04:30 PM to 08:30 PM. Afternoon closure is observed across Braj temples.
Footwear must be deposited at the free shoe counter near the entrance. Smartphones are generally permitted in outer courtyards, but photography is strictly prohibited inside the inner sanctum where deities are enshrined.
